Ronin is the Japanese word used for Samurai without a master. In this case, the Ronin are outcast specialists of every kind, whose services are available to everyone - for money. Dierdre (undoubtedly from Ireland) hires several Ronin to form a team in order to retrieve an important suitcase from a man who is about to sell it to the Russians. After the mission has been completed successfully, the suitcase immediately gets switched by a member of the team who seems to work into his own pocket. The complex net of everyone tricking everyone begins to surface slowly, and deadly... RONIN is somewhat better than the average action film, as it focuses more on the development of the characters and the storyline than most movies in this genre. As with many action films, there are lots of mandatory car chases and shoot-outs to be found here (perhaps more than necessary), but many (not all) of the action sequences are actually logical and appeal to the cerebral as well as the visceral. Screenwriter David Mamet (writing under the pseudonym Richard Weisz) went to great lengths to avoid the many annoying clichés found in this genre, and even throws in a Hitchcock-styled McGuffin (as seen in PULP FICTION and MISSION:IMPOSSIBLE III, to name a few) for good measure.

The acting is a large part of what sets this movie apart from many of its kind, as the all-star ensemble of Robert DeNiro, Jean Reno, Sean Bean, Stellan Skarsgard, and Natascha McElhone do remarkable well in a genre that doesn't usually require much in the way of acting.

Cinematographer Robert Fraisse also did well to infuse a sort of noir element in this movie. I cannot remember the last time a movie featuring the flamboyant city of Paris looked so devoid of flair and colour.

Bottom line: There's plenty to be had in RONIN; lots of action for the visceral action fans, excellent dialogue and acting, a great screenplay, decent storyline, and good music. In the end, this film deserves a solid 8/10 and 3 stars (out of 4). May or may not earn a place in my 'Honourable Mentions' list. Recommended. I cannot work out why everyone seems to like this film so much. The excellent cast is wasted on a weak plot that is full of holes, and the technically great stunts are wasted because the way the action scenes occur is so contrived. We also are left with no idea as to why any of this is occurring, except for some vague notion about DeNiro's job of trying to assassinate 'Seamus', (which he was, incidentally, particularly bad at- if he'd had 'Deirdre' tailed to one of her meetings early on, we would have been spared most of the film).

The constant desire to obtain the 'Mysterious Package' became so tiresome. I think it could be that no-one could think of something important enough that could be in the package, so they didn't bother telling us what it was.

The film's attitude to innocent bystanders was very strange- The director seemed to enjoy showing us as many innocent people as possible buying it, for no good reason. None of the characters seemed to care, and I in turn found it hard to care about the main characters. If you don't care about the people you're watching, there's no tension.

And Jean Reno's speach at the end: "... perhaps that is the third lesson..." etc, could the script-writers have found any more cliches to use? I think not, they used them all.

The CIA want it to convict the Russians. The man with the case wants to sell it and make a quick buck. Ronin has loads of cars. The main ones in order of appearances include: (1) Volkswagen (original) van, (2) Audi S8 D2 Quattro (fitted with a nitrous oxide power-booster) (car driven by Larry), (3) Volvo Estate V70 R AWD, (4) BMW 5 Series (in tunnel), (5) Peugeot 306 estate police car, (6) Peugeot 205GL (police car chasing the Audi), (7) Citroen XM V6 (the get away car outside the Majestic), (8) Peugeot 306 diesel estate police car, (9) Peugeot Expert van (could be named differently on mainland Europe), (10) Peugeot 605 (lead and follow the Citroen XM in the chase), (11) Mercedes-Benz 450SEL 6.9 W116 (car driven by Vincent at the ambush), (12) Shooting scene cars Renault Laguna, Renault 25 and Renault Espace and Citroen Xantia, (13) Fiat Uno, (14) Jeep Cherokee, (15) Peugeot 106, (16) Citroen Xantia, (17) Rover 400, (18) Renault Laguna, (19) Volkswagen Golf CL (car stolen by Vincent after they are left behind), (20) Peugeot 406 Mk1 (Sam's Paris chase car), (21) BMW M5 E34 (Deirdre's Paris chase car), (22) Renault 5 (post van), (23) Renault Prima (post van), (24) Mercedes 500E (the camera car towing the 406), (25) Citroen ZX police car, (26) Citroen Saxo / Peugeot 406 crash, (27) Renault 21 crash in tunnel, (28) Peugeot 306, Peugeot 106, DAF truck crash, (29) Peugeot 306 (final get away car), and (30) Citroen Xantia. According to reports, over 75 cars were wrecked during the production.
